Facebook Marketplace is flooded with cheap telescopes right now, and it's three separate things dumping glass onto the used market at the same time. Pandemic buyers finally cleaning out the garage. Owners who switched to a $499 smart scope and don't need the old rig. And serious hobbyists cashing out mid-tier gear to fund the next setup. The reason a seller quit tells you almost everything about whether their scope is worth the drive.
Two of those waves are goldmines. One of them is the $40 Christmas refractor that killed somebody's interest in astronomy over two evenings, and you can spot it in the listing photo before you ever reply.
You also get four checks that take ten minutes in a driveway, plus real 2026 price anchors. An 8-inch Dobsonian that cost $650 to $700 new is fair around $300 to $350 with eyepieces. Anything asking above 60 percent of new, don't bother haggling. Another listing shows up tomorrow.
